Elsie Virginia Charshee

Female 1910 - 2004  (93 years)


Generations:      Standard    |    Vertical    |    Compact    |    Box    |    Text    |    Ahnentafel    |    Fan Chart    |    Media    |    PDF

Generation: 1

  1. 1.  Elsie Virginia Charshee was born 31 Mar 1910, Havre de Grace, Maryland (daughter of George Johnson Charshee and Sarah Elizabeth 'Sadie' Clark); died 22 Mar 2004, Havre de Grace, Maryland; was buried , Angel Hill Cemetery, Havre de Grace, Maryland.

    Elsie married Frank Smith Maslin 16 Jun 1935 (by the Rev. R. Allen Brown), Harford County, Maryland. Frank was born 19 Oct 1908, Havre de Grace, Maryland; died 1 May 1994, Havre de Grace, maryland; was buried , Angel Hill Cemetery, Havre de Grace, Maryland. [Group Sheet]


Generation: 2

  1. 2.  George Johnson Charshee was born 18 Sep 1880, Rochester, New York (son of Robert Thomas Charshee and Emma Parker Barnard); died 8 Dec 1938, Sabillasville Sanatorium, Frederick County, Maryland; was buried , Angel Hill Cemetery, Havre de Grace, Maryland.

    George married Sarah Elizabeth 'Sadie' Clark. Sarah was born 29 Sep 1882, Maryland; died 7 Oct 1956, Havre de Grace, Maryland; was buried , Angel Hill Cemetery, Harford County, Maryland. [Group Sheet]


  2. 3.  Sarah Elizabeth 'Sadie' Clark was born 29 Sep 1882, Maryland; died 7 Oct 1956, Havre de Grace, Maryland; was buried , Angel Hill Cemetery, Harford County, Maryland.
    Children:
    1. Marguerite Charshee was born 4 Jun 1912, Havre de Grace, Maryland; died 15 Apr 1947, Eudowood Sanatorium, Towson, Maryland; was buried , Angel Hill Cemetery, Harford County, Maryland.
    2. 1. Elsie Virginia Charshee was born 31 Mar 1910, Havre de Grace, Maryland; died 22 Mar 2004, Havre de Grace, Maryland; was buried , Angel Hill Cemetery, Havre de Grace, Maryland.
    3. William Robert Charshee was born 22 Jan 1906, Havre de Grace, Maryland; died 17 May 1968, Anne Arundel County, Maryland; was buried , Holy Redreemer Cemetery, Baltimore, maryland.
    4. Richard Clark Charshee was born 11 Sep 1922, Havre de Grace, Maryland; died 22 Feb 2004, Havre de Grace, Maryland; was buried , Angel Hill Cemetery, Havre de Grace, Maryland.


Generation: 3

  1. 4.  Robert Thomas Charshee was born 9 May 1859, Perryville, Maryland (son of Edward Charles Charshe/Charsha and Harriet F. Barnard); died 14 Oct 1909, Baltimore City, Maryland; was buried , Angel Hill Cemetery, Havre de Grace, Maryland.

    Robert married Emma Parker Barnard. Emma was born 28 Jul 1855, Maryland; died 30 Jan 1928, at the home of her son George J. in Havre de Grace, Maryland; was buried , Angel Hill Cemetery, Harford County, Maryland. [Group Sheet]


  2. 5.  Emma Parker Barnard was born 28 Jul 1855, Maryland; died 30 Jan 1928, at the home of her son George J. in Havre de Grace, Maryland; was buried , Angel Hill Cemetery, Harford County, Maryland.
    Children:
    1. 2. George Johnson Charshee was born 18 Sep 1880, Rochester, New York; died 8 Dec 1938, Sabillasville Sanatorium, Frederick County, Maryland; was buried , Angel Hill Cemetery, Havre de Grace, Maryland.
    2. Harriet Ford Charshee was born 1 Jun 1884, harford County, Maryland; died 22 Nov 1906, Baltimore City, Maryland; was buried , Angel Hill Cemetery, Harford County, Maryland.
    3. Ella/Ellen Taylor Charshee was born 21 May 1886, Wilmington, Delaware; died 21 May 1886, Wilmington, Delaware; was buried , Perryville, Maryland.
    4. Maud Parker Charshee was born 23 Nov 1887, Wilmington, Delaware; died 19 Jun 1888, Wilmington, Delaware; was buried , Angel Hill Cemetery, Havre de Grace, Maryland.


Generation: 4

  1. 8.  Edward Charles Charshe/Charsha was born 21 Jan 1818, Harford County, Maryland (son of James Charshe/Charsha/Charshee and 'Annie' Anne Nancy Fletcher); died 21 May 1888, Cecil County, Maryland; was buried , St. Marks Episcopal Church Cemetery, Cecil County, Maryland.

    Edward married Harriet F. Barnard 21 Mar 1854, Cecil County, Maryland. Harriet was born 6 Mar 1831, Harford County, Maryland; died 19 Jan 1883, Cecil County, Maryland; was buried , St. Marks Cemetery, Cecil County, Maryland. [Group Sheet]


  2. 9.  Harriet F. Barnard was born 6 Mar 1831, Harford County, Maryland; died 19 Jan 1883, Cecil County, Maryland; was buried , St. Marks Cemetery, Cecil County, Maryland.
    Children:
    1. James Gover Charsha was born 6 Feb 1855, Cecil County, Maryland; died 31 Oct 1911, Colwyn, Pennsylvania; was buried , Riverview Cemetery, Wilmington, Delaware.
    2. Anna Elizabeth Charshe was born 22 Jan 1858, Maryland; died 21 Jul 1891, Near Principio Furnace, Cecil County, Maryland; was buried , Principio Cemetery, Cecil County, Maryland.
    3. 4. Robert Thomas Charshee was born 9 May 1859, Perryville, Maryland; died 14 Oct 1909, Baltimore City, Maryland; was buried , Angel Hill Cemetery, Havre de Grace, Maryland.
    4. Edward Wrightson Charsha was born 15 Mar 1861, Cecil County, Maryland; died 2 Sep 1886, Perryville, Maryland; was buried , Principio Furnace Cemetery, Cecil County, Maryland.
    5. Lorenzo Gerrard Charshe/Charsha was born 8 Oct 1869, Cecil County, Maryland; died 14 Mar 1890, Baltimore City, Baltimore, Maryland; was buried , St. Mark's Church Cemetery, Cecil County, Maryland.
    6. George William Charshee was born 8 Jan 1871; died 28 Dec 1939, Kent County, Delaware; was buried , Barratt's Chapel Cemetery, Frederica, Delaware.
    7. John Clarence Charsha was born 25 Sep 1872, Perryville, Maryland; died 21 Dec 1928, Delaware Memorial Hospital, Wilmington, Delaware; was buried , St. Mark's Cemetery, Perryville, Maryland.
